After careful thought and discussion, the Board of Directors has three rule clarifications and one rule amendment to share with you:
Rule Amendment:
Due to safety concerns, Sign 202 – Dog Circles Left will no longer be included in the Intermediate level.
This change will apply to all course maps submitted for approval after 1 October 2025.
Rule Clarification #1:
If a team performs a spin while heeling between stations, it is considered an out of position deduction, not an NQ. However, a spin performed as an unrequired position during a stationremains an NQ as per section 3.1 of the 2025 Rally Handbook.
Rule Clarification #2:
In Working, if a dog spins on the way to the dog box, it is an NY. If a dog spins while completing cone stations (Barrel Racing and Around the Clock, it is fine, as long as they are doing the correct pattern.
Rule Clarification #3:
When nesting courses, 50% of station signs must be swapped out or change location from one map to the next within the same level.
(Example: If there are 16 stations in a course, including Start & Finish, 8 stations must be changed.)
